The polynomial to be subtracted is derived from the multiplication of the first term of the quotient and is given as: x³ + 2x²
<h3>What are polynomials?</h3>
Polynomials are mathematical expressions consisting of variables, constants and exponents, which are combined using mathematical operations such as addition, subtraction, multiplication and division.
The long division is as follows:
(x³ + 3x² + x) ÷ x + 2
The first quotient will be x².
Multiplying (x + 2) and x² gives the polynomial to be subtracted from the dividend.
(x + 2)×(x²) = x³ + 2x²
Therefore, the polynomial to be subtracted is x³ + 2x².

Conditions for inference:
To build a confidence interval for a population proportion, the sample must have at least 10 successes and 10 failures.
In this question:
50 cars, 11 have damage and 50 - 11 = 39 do not.
Since both the number of sucesses and of failures is above 10, conditions for inference are met.
